Are you looking for an exciting role based in beautiful coastal Cornwall? This is an excellent opportunity to join The SU, located on the stunning, award-winning campuses at Penryn and Falmouth, leading our activities programme:

  • Enable and support outstanding and engaging activities aligned with our vision, mission, values, and organizing principles for the student community in Cornwall.
  • Lead the development of approaches, guidance, and support for student-led communities, groups, activities, projects, and events, empowering students to lead both on and off campus and fostering a sense of community and belonging.
  • Manage and inspire a vibrant team of professional staff, fostering a culture of collaboration, support, and motivation.
  • Support and motivate Sabbatical Officers and the wider staff team through coaching, guidance, and leadership.
  • Support, motivate, and develop student volunteers and promote volunteering opportunities within the community.
  • Engage in personal leadership development through ongoing professional development.
  • Contribute to shaping the new strategic plan for the next three to five years.

About Falmouth and Exeter Students' Union

You will be employed directly by The SU. We are a membership-led charity run by students, for students, representing students from Falmouth University and the University of Exeter.

Falmouth University has over 100 years of history in creative thinking and design innovation, evolving from Falmouth School of Art in 1902 to a digital innovation hub impacting lives and economies through new knowledge, solutions, services, and products.

The University of Exeter is a member of the Russell Group, ranking among the top 150 universities worldwide, combining world-class teaching with research excellence, and received a Gold rating in the TEF 2017.

We are an equal opportunities employer committed to promoting equality and diversity. We expect all staff, students, and volunteers to share this commitment.
